Output dd6563d523de4ede1448551558951ca2d52f1c0420adedbcb633bf63bdf76cc6: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edb28fe22a13de49199aa74777fd94a62689ced7 OP_EQUAL
address
AE76iZYZVY26qBhUTqhNz8cDyXjntsN9Dm
transaction
dd6563d523de4ede1448551558951ca2d52f1c0420adedbcb633bf63bdf76cc6